Excalibur Holdings LLC

Call
Website

Advertisement

900 Foulk Rd
Wilmington, DE 19803

Excalibur Holdings LLC is a multifaceted company based in Wilmington, DE, specializing in a range of business services and investments.

With a focus on strategic planning and financial management, Excalibur Holdings LLC offers tailored solutions to help businesses achieve their goals and maximize their potential.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esDelawareWilmingtonExcalibur Holdings LLC

Advertisement